Core Features: Engineering Analysis of the CAT Power Haulers Wheel Loader
To truly understand why this 11.5-inch powerhouse stands out in the crowded toy vehicle market, we must break down its technical specifications, build quality, and operational capabilities. Every feature is designed to mirror heavy-duty earthmoving equipment.
- Motion Drive Technology Integration: The hallmark feature of this unit. Unlike traditional friction-motor toys, the internal motion sensor detects velocity and direction changes instantly, triggering realistic hydraulic lifting sounds and engine roars without requiring complex remote controls or app pairing.
- Robust Industrial Build: Built to withstand aggressive outdoor sandbox excavation, indoor carpet crawling, and rough-and-tumble toddler play. The high-impact resin chassis resists cracking and UV degradation.
- Fully Functional Articulated Loader Arm: Just like a full-scale Caterpillar D8 bulldozer or wheel loader, the front bucket mechanism features true-to-life articulation points, allowing kids to scoop, lift, and dump heavy loads of sand, gravel, or blocks with precise manual control.
- Immersive LED Lighting & Sound Suite: Integrated flashing safety lights and multi-stage audio profiles activate dynamically based on vehicle movement, creating an authentic jobsite atmosphere.
- Ergonomic Scale (11.5 Inches): Sized perfectly for children ages 3 and up—large enough to provide a substantial, heavy-duty feel in small hands, yet compact enough for easy indoor storage and travel.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Here are answers to the most common questions regarding the CAT Construction 11.5″ Power Haulers Wheel Loader:
- Does this toy require remote control batteries?
No, the CAT Power Haulers Wheel Loader does not use a remote control. It operates entirely via internal Motion Drive Technology sensors that respond directly to the child pushing or pulling the vehicle. - Are batteries included in the package?
Yes, “Try Me” demo batteries are included so the lights and sounds work right out of the box. However, for optimal long-term performance, we recommend replacing them with fresh alkaline batteries shortly after purchase. - Can this toy be used outdoors in sand and mud?
Absolutely. The heavy-duty resin build and sealed electronic compartments make it fully compatible with outdoor sandbox play, dirt mounds, and gravel pits. Simply rinse with water after muddy sessions. - What age group is this toy designed for?
The manufacturer recommends this toy for children ages 3 years and older due to its robust size, choking hazard safety standards, and ease of mechanical operation. - How does Motion Drive Technology work?
Internal velocity and directional sensors detect when the vehicle is pushed forward or backward, automatically engaging synchronized engine sounds, hydraulic lifting effects, and LED warning lights without complex programming.
